Why Your Plant May Look Different

Most of our plants are grown emersed. (Roots in water, leaves/stems out of water). This means the plant will melt (shed its "air" grown leaves) when submerged in your aquarium and grow back its submerged growth.

Many plants have VERY different looks (leaf shape, size, and color) when comparing their Emerged growth to their Submerged growth. This is very common. When you submerge your plant in your aquarium, it will melt back (this does not mean it is dying or dead) and grow back it's submerged growth which is will resemble the picture used for this plant.

Red Plants may need more iron (Fe) supplement than other plants to achieve their best look. Iron (Fe) is the mineral that causes the red to appear. Please research your plants and provide them the environment and nutrients they need to thrive.

Some Plants May Not Arrive Red:

  • Red plants require Iron (Fe), research the plants you receive for best outcome and color
  • Some plants begin to turn red as they mature, we provide young plants so you can enjoy the lifespan
  • Our plants are grown emersed to be submerged after delivery. This will drastically change appearance
